Tian'anmen Gate replica made out of human hair

Chinese hairdresser Huang Xin carries a replica of the Tian'anmen Gate that he made from human hair, at his barbershop in Beijing August 3, 2009. Huang used 11kg (24 lbs) of hair cut from his customers over a five month period to create the replica. Huang started making reproductions from human hair in early 2008, including the National Stadium (also known as the Bird's Nest), the National Aquatics Centre (also known as the Water Cube), two Olympic torches and the Olympic rings.
